For the last Film Festival of this month, we would like to share with you this series of short films from Conservation International called “Nature Is Speaking”.

“Nature is Speaking” is an invitation to the human race to listen to nature. All films are narrated by Hollywood talents to deliver messages from the earth, forests, ocean and other natural elements.

Nature is essential to every aspect of human life and well-being. Unfortunately, people are taking more from nature than it has to give, and as a result, we’re putting our own lives on the line.

Nature’s message to humanity is simple: Nature doesn’t need people. People need nature.

List of films:
– Julia Roberts is MOTHER NATURE
– Penelope Cruz is WATER
– Shailene Woodly is FOREST
– Harrison Ford is OCEAN
– Joan Chen is SKY
– Reese Witherspoon is HOME
– Lee Pace is MOUNTAIN
– Liam Neeson is ICE
– Kevin Spacey is RAINFOREST CONSERVATION
– Robert Redford is REDWOOD
– Edward Norton is SOIL
– Mila is BEE
– Lupita Nyong’o is FLOWER
– Ian Somerhalder is CORAL REEF
